Brass Bar Overview

Brass Bars are non-ferrous engineering materials manufactured using copper-zinc alloys designed for applications requiring excellent machinability, corrosion resistance, thermal conductivity, and dimensional precision. These bars are widely used in fastener manufacturing, electrical systems, decorative fabrication, marine engineering, valve components, and industrial precision machining.

Depending on industrial application requirements, brass bars are supplied in Round Bar, Square Bar, and Hexagonal Bar forms with multiple surface finishes and machining conditions suitable for fabrication and engineering systems.

Brass Bar Shapes We Supply

Brass Round Bars

Brass Round Bars are extensively used in precision machining, electrical connectors, valve components, plumbing systems, decorative applications, and industrial engineering projects requiring excellent machinability and corrosion resistance. Their circular profile allows smooth rotation during machining operations and improved dimensional stability for precision-manufactured parts.

These bars are widely used in marine engineering, electrical industries, and architectural fabrication systems because of their superior conductivity, attractive finish quality, and dependable long-term performance in moderate corrosive environments.

Brass Square Bars

Brass Square Bars are commonly used in architectural fabrication, decorative engineering, support systems, industrial frameworks, and precision-machined assemblies requiring dimensional consistency and improved structural rigidity.

The flat-sided geometry of square bars helps simplify fabrication and machining operations while providing excellent surface finish quality for decorative and engineering applications. Brass square bars are also preferred for utility systems and custom-manufactured industrial components.

Brass Hex Bars

Brass Hex Bars are widely used in fastener manufacturing, threaded components, electrical fittings, nuts, bolts, valves, and CNC-machined industrial parts because of their excellent machinability and easy gripping during machining processes.

The hexagonal profile helps reduce machining time and material wastage during production operations. Brass hexagonal bars are highly preferred for manufacturing precision fasteners, plumbing fittings, and electrical engineering components requiring accurate threading and smooth surface finish quality.

Brass Bar Grade Comparison

Grade Key Property Machinability Typical Industrial Usage Core Advantage
UNS C36000 Free machining brass Excellent Fasteners & CNC parts Superior machinability
UNS C37700 Forging brass Very Good Valve & plumbing fittings Good hot forging capability
UNS C46400 Naval brass Good Marine engineering Corrosion resistance
UNS C38500 Architectural brass Good Decorative systems Smooth surface finish
UNS C26000 Cartridge brass Very Good Electrical & fabricated parts Formability

UNS C36000 brass bars are widely used for CNC machining and fastener manufacturing because of their excellent machinability, while UNS C46400 grades are preferred for marine engineering applications because of their corrosion resistance.

Mechanical Properties of Brass Bars

Grade Tensile Strength (MPa) Yield Strength (MPa) Key Property
UNS C36000 340 125 Free machinability
UNS C37700 360 140 Forging capability
UNS C46400 380 145 Marine corrosion resistance
UNS C38500 345 130 Surface finish quality
UNS C26000 315 95 Formability

Chemical Composition of Brass Bars

Grade Copper (%) Zinc (%) Lead (%)
UNS C36000 60 – 63 Balance 2.5 – 3.7
UNS C37700 57 – 61 Balance 1 – 2.5
UNS C46400 59 – 62 Balance
UNS C38500 57 – 60 Balance 1.5 – 3.5
UNS C26000 68.5 – 71.5 Balance
